Dade County Citizen Seeking 100 Signatures To Recall Townsend.

One Dade County citizen has taken matters into his own hands and begun a recall against the county’s current County Executive, Don Townsend. Coy Williams, Jr., the owner of McBride’s Bookstore, and known throughout by his stage name, Bubba Que has filed a petition to recall our county executive because, according to Mr. Williams Jr., “they don’t care what the citizens want as long as the rich get richer and the poor get poorer! This “man” wants to steal $3 million from us.”

(PHOTO CREDIT OF COY WILLIAMS, JR: Per Coy Williams, Jr. & PHOTO CREDIT OF PATRICK ‘DON’ TOWNSEND: Per the Dade County, Georgia Official Website)

The Trenton Daily News spoke in person with Mr. Williams, Jr., today, where they verified that he had indeed gotten certified recall paperwork regarding County Executive Townsend today, Thursday, August 21, 2025, and he has already begun getting signatures from registered voters in Dade County.

We asked him why recalling the county executive is important to him, with his answer being, “I think it’s important because elected officials need to remember why and who they are elected for and who pays their salaries.”…
